polymer film (primarily TPU) uses a calendering process: the molten polymer exits the die head and passes between two textured rollers, <strong>350<\/strong> and <strong>450 mm<\/strong> in diameter, which laminate it and impart a matte micro-embossed pattern. The rollers are internally cooled with water at <strong>5\u201310 \u00b0C<\/strong>, but their surfaces operate at room temperature due to the heat transferred by the film.<\/p>\n\n\n\n<p>The problem was adhesion. The hot TPU stuck to the roller that receives the polymer and had trouble peeling off, both at the main point of contact and at the exit of the second roller. The customer had empirically verified that a thin layer of moisture on the surface solved the release issue and had built their own solution: an open stainless-steel channel through which water at about <strong>70\u201390 \u00b0C<\/strong> flowed, located beneath the roller, with the steam condensing on the surface.<\/p>\n\n\n\n<p>The system worked, but with serious limitations. Flow control was poor: there was no way to precisely regulate how much moisture reached the roller. And the margin for error was narrow, because excess water eliminates the micro-relief and ruins the film\u2019s finish. Added to this were the machine\u2019s limitations: the rollers move along two axes and tilt by about  <strong>20\u00b0<\/strong>  to adjust the pressure between them, so any device had to be compact, lightweight, capable of accommodating those movements, and easily removable. Production runs last  <strong>72 hours<\/strong>  in succession, so the solution had to operate continuously and uniformly along the entire generatrix of the roller, at the lowest possible outlet velocity to avoid generating noise and, if possible, without dripping, so that it could be positioned overhead.<\/p>\n\n\n\n<p>The customer needed to transition from uncontrolled steam to a uniform steam supply, adjustable within a range of <strong>0.6 to 6 kg\/h<\/strong> and tailored to the geometry of its calender. Since it is electric, it starts up in minutes, requires no chimney or fuel, and can be integrated into the production area without any construction work.<\/p>\n\n\n\n<p>For the distribution system, we designed two stainless steel tubular manifolds made of  <strong>22 mm<\/strong>  in diameter and  <strong>1,750 mm<\/strong>  in length, with dual connections and outlet holes every  <strong>10 mm<\/strong>, so that every centimeter of the roller receives the same amount of steam. Each manifold is mounted on a channel-type support, secured to the side frames of the calender and integrated with the rollers\u2019 movements: the diffuser follows the roller as it moves or tilts, without the need for any readjustment. The design was based on measurements and photographs taken from a plan view and was validated in  <strong>3D<\/strong>  before manufacturing, with the intention of replacing the manifolds with longer ones if the usable working width is expanded in the future.<\/p>\n\n\n\n<p>The control system was designed to be deliberately simple. The client wanted to validate the concept before investing in automation, so control is achieved using a needle valve at the inlet of each manifold, preceded by a droplet separator that minimizes condensation and dripping during startup. Insulated hoses carry the steam from the generator to the calender. The system is designed to accommodate automatic temperature control at a later date, if necessary.<\/p>\n\n\n\n<p>The project was completed in <strong>five months<\/strong>, from the initial consultation to commissioning, and included a technical site visit to collect data, the design of custom-made supports at Giconmes, and a single day of installation. Can it be controlled and adjusted according to needs?    <\/button>\n\n    <div class=\"faqs-content\">\n        <div class=\"mt-1 mb-2\"><p class=\"p1\">It is known that by applying heat to water, it transforms into steam at the boiling point and atmospheric pressure. From there, depending on the required saturation degree of steam for its proper application, we need to increase the pressure to obtain a higher temperature. To change the temperature and saturation degree of steam, we always need to modify the pressure.<\/p>\n<\/div>\n    <\/div>\n\n        \n    <button class=\"faqs-btn\">\n        <span>\n
